Processor Power Signals
Table 41. Processor Power Signals
Signal Name Description Direction / Buffer
Type
VCC Processor core power rail. Ref
VCCIO_OUT Processor power reference for I/O. Ref
VDDQ Processor I/O supply voltage for DDR3. Ref
VCOMP_OUT Processor power reference for PEG/Display RCOMP. Ref

Processor Internal Pull-Up / Pull-Down Terminations
Table 44. Processor Internal Pull-Up / Pull-Down Terminations
Signal Name Pull Up / Pull Down Rail Value
BPM[7:0] Pull Up VCCIO_TERM 40–60 Ω
PREQ# Pull Up VCCIO_TERM 40–60 Ω
TDI Pull Up VCCIO_TERM 30–70 Ω
TMS Pull Up VCCIO_TERM 30–70 Ω
CFG[17:0] Pull Up VCCIO_OUT 5–8 kΩ
CATERR# Pull Up VCCIO_TERM 30–70 Ω
